Menard.jpg

Officer assigned to Colonel Edwards at the naquadah dig site on P3X-403. Menard was responsible for delivering crucial readings of a stronger concentration of naquadah that turned out to be a mine yielding approximately 53,000 metric tons of the rare and valuable mineral.

DETAILS

PLAYED BY - Michael Shore
FIRST APPEARED - Enemy Mine

KEY EPISODE

Enemy Mine - SG-1 finds Menard and his team on P3X-403, where they have recently discovered a significant deposit of the valuable mineral naquadah.
